The RING finger protein 8 (RNF8)-induced ubiquitination signaling cascade promotes DNA repair and maintains genomic stability. Our study reveals an unexpected action of RNF8 in promoting cancer metastasis, cancer stem cell formation, and chemoresistance through the regulation of TWIST lysine 63 (K63)-linked ubiquitination, suggesting that RNF8 may serve as a new cancer prognosis marker and therapeutic target.
